25 year old youth goes missing in Bandipora, family appeals him to return | KNO

Efforts are on to trace the missing youth: Police

Bandipora, June 14 (KNO) : A 25-year-old youth has gone missing from Kharpora village of Bandipora district.The family has appealed him to return home. Reports reaching KNO said that a 25 year old youth namely Umar Shaban Wani son of Mohammad Shaban Wani has gone missing since June 02 after he left home for his routine work. “He is an auto driver and left home for routine work but didn’t return in evening. His phone is also switched off,” one of the family members told KNO. They said they also contacted his friends and relatives but in vain. “We have filed a missing report at Police Station Bandipora,” family members told KNO. The family members of Umar urged deputy commissioner Bandipora and SSP Bandipora to help in locating their missing son. A Senior police officer told KNO that they have received a missing report and a complaint has been lodged in the concern police station. “We are investigating the matter and efforts are on to trace him as well,” he said. Officer said any anybody having any information regarding the said youth can contact on the below number 9596767411.(KNO)
